Liam Payne’s girlfriend Kate Cassidy has revealed she first learned of his tragic death after getting a phonecall from one of his friends.
The One Direction star died in October last year after falling from a balcony on the third-floor of his hotel room in Buenos Aires, Argentina, where he had been on holiday to see his former bandmate Niall Horan perform.
Kate, 25, was with Liam in Argentina but left a day early in order to to look after their rescue dog Nala at their home in Florida, and in her first interview since she’s passing, she’s admitted she ‘didn’t believe it’ when she learned of his death.
She told The Sun: ‘I feel blessed I didn’t find out over social media because I just couldn’t even imagine that. I was in our home with our dog, scrolling TikTok and one of Liam’s friends called me.
‘That moment, it’s like blank; it’s blacked out in my head. I didn’t believe it at first. I thought it was just a rumour. Or something that somebody made up just to get views. Then instantly I just had a bad feeling in my gut. I was like, ”Why would somebody make this up? Is this true?”
‘And I feel like I just completely blacked out. When I officially found the news out to be true, I felt numb. I tried to call him. I called pretty much everybody.’

Kate went onto share that she ‘didn’t sleep at all’ the night she learned of Liam’s death, and admitted that his phone ‘rang out’ when she tried to call it.
She later realised that her last text to Liam had been completely ordinary: ‘I can’t wait for you to get home and see the house.’ She had spent time decorating their home for Halloween and was excited to show him.
She said she knew the pair were soulmates from the very first time they met, which was when she was a waitress in South Carolina, but that she had loved him since she was 10-years-old, believing that they were always meant to meet.
Liam delayed his flight home, and the pair spent two days together in a hotel, beginning what she describes as a ‘fairytale romance’.
The devastated girlfriend called the singer the most humble and charming people she had ever met and insisted she was not to blame for the death of her partner.
Kate later left her college plans behind and became a full-time influencer, a career Liam fully supported.
Now with more than 2.5million followers, she has since moved back to New Jersey after leaving the home they shared in Florida.
Liam had spoken openly about his mental health struggles and past battles with addiction. He had tried both therapy and rehab.

On the night of his death, his hotel room was littered with drug paraphernalia and an opened champagne bottle.
Kate said his relapse seemed to come ‘out of nowhere’, and she had never imagined he was in such a fragile state.
Still reeling from his death, she has been seeing a grief therapist and struggles to listen to Liam’s music. ‘Maybe one day,’ she said, ‘but not right now.’
Liam was staying at the Casa Sur hotel in Buenos Aires when he fell to his death after a drink-drug binge on October 16.
His medical cause of death has now been announced to be ‘polytrauma’, a term which means a person has multiple traumatic injuries to their body.
Five people have been charged over the singer’s death in Argentina after he fell from a third-floor balcony of the hotel.
The hotel’s manager, a receptionist and a friend of Payne have been charged with manslaughter, Argentina’s National Criminal and Correctional Prosecutor’s Office previously said in a statement.
They are reported to be hotel manager Gilda Martin, receptionist Esteban Grassi and Payne’s friend Roger Nores. Two other people have been charged over the supply of drugs.
Due to the ongoing investigation, Kate could not divulge too much information and did not confirm whether or not she had spoken to Roger.
She insisted, however, that when she left Argentina, Liam was in ‘such a good headspace’ and the couple were more in love than ever.
